Details
A vulnerability was found in Google Android (Smartphone Operating System) (affected version unknown). It has been declared as critical. Affected by this vulnerability is an unknown functionality of the component Qualcomm WLAN. The manipulation with an unknown input leads to a memory corruption vulnerability. The CWE definition for the vulnerability is C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. As an impact it is known to affect confidentiality, integrity, and availability.
The bug was discovered 01/05/2018. The weakness was shared 01/02/2018 as Pixel?/?Nexus Security Bulletin - January 2018 as confirmed security bulletin (Website). It is possible to read the advisory at source.android.com. This vulnerability is known as CVE-2017-11081 since 07/07/2017. The exploitation appears to be easy. Attacking locally is a requirement. The exploitation doesn't need any form of authentication. The technical details are unknown and an exploit is not publicly available.
Applying a patch is able to eliminate this problem. A possible mitigation has been published immediately after the disclosure of the vulnerability.
